Bengaluru Stampede: RCB’s IPL Victory Celebration Turns Tragic As 11 Die in Crowd Crush at Chinnaswamy Stadium

A stampede broke out in the immediate vicinity of M Chinnaswamy stadium in Bengaluru on Wednesday, June 04, during celebrations for the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) cricket team's maiden IPL title win. At least 11 people died in the stampede that occurred after massive crowds arrived to attend a felicitation event organised for the RCB team. Overcrowding and attempted forced entry by cricket enthusiasts who did not have entry tickets are said to be some of the major reasons that led to the tragic incident. The Congress-led Karnataka government has appointed Bengaluru Urban Deputy Commissioner and District Magistrate G Jagadeesha as the inquiry officer to investigate the stampede.
